Output 530384f6ae1afeccb93e13e6640227b06b6c8efd91f580f62d3ebc19533140d5:1

value
531087187
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d9e3a6eacd0764814d376f67dace01bae8fbf74c OP_EQUALVERIFY OP_CHECKSIG
address
1Ls6MAgMLzEPLKycDT3jy47dDeeyWVB4LH
transaction
530384f6ae1afeccb93e13e6640227b06b6c8efd91f580f62d3ebc19533140d5
spent
true